Как создать java приложение?

Как создать java приложение? - коротко

Для создания Java-приложения необходимо установить Java Development Kit (JDK) и выбрать интегрированную среду разработки (IDE), такую как IntelliJ IDEA или Eclipse. После установки IDE следует создать новый проект, добавить необходимые зависимости и написать код в соответствии с требованиями проекта.

Как создать java приложение? - развернуто

Создание Java-приложения включает несколько этапов, каждый из которых требует внимания к деталям и понимания основных концепций языка программирования.

  1. Установка среды разработки (IDE): Для начала необходимо установить интегрированную среду разработки, такую как IntelliJ IDEA, Eclipse или NetBeans. Эти инструменты предоставляют функции для написания, компиляции и отладки кода.

  2. Настройка среды разработки: После установки IDE следует настроить её для работы с Java-проектами. В большинстве случаев это включает в себя создание нового проекта и выбор соответствующего шаблона.

  3. Создание основного класса: В Java приложении обычно существует точка входа, представляющая собой метод main в классе. Этот метод вызывается для начала выполнения программы. Пример такого класса:

public class Main {
 public static void main(String[] args) {
 System.out.println("Hello, World!");
 }
}
  1. Написание кода: В процессе написания кода программист создаёт классы и методы, которые будут выполнять необходимые функции. Важно следовать принципам объектно-ориентированного программирования (ООП), таким как инкапсуляция, наследование и полиморфизм.

  2. Использование библиотек и фреймворков: Для ускорения разработки и использования готовых решений часто применяются внешние библиотеки и фреймворки, такие как Spring для создания web приложений или Hibernate для работы с базами данных.

  3. Компиляция кода: Java-код компилируется в байт-код, который затем интерпретируется виртуальной машиной (JVM). Для компиляции используется инструмент javac, который преобразует исходный код в файлы с расширением .class.

  4. Тестирование: На этом этапе необходимо провести тестирование приложения для выявления ошибок и убедиться, что все функции работают корректно. Для автоматизации тестирования можно использовать инструменты, такие как JUnit.

  5. Отладка: При обнаружении ошибк или исключений необходимо провести отладку кода. В IDE предоставляются инструменты для пошагового выполнения программы, установки точек останова и анализа стека вызовов.

  6. Сборка и деплоймент: После завершения разработки и тестирования приложение собирается в исполняемый файл или war/jar-файл для дальнейшего развертывания на сервере или клиентском устройстве.

  7. Мониторинг и поддержка: После развертывания приложения необходимо проводить мониторинг его работы, обновлять в случае необходимости и осуществлять техническую поддержку для исправления возникающих проблем.

Следуя этим этапам, можно создать функциональное и надежное Java-приложение, которое будет соответствовать поставленным требованиям и ожиданиям пользователей.